Description
An archaeological evaluation was carried out on 1.7ha of arable land off of Mobbs Way, Oulton, in advance of development. Trenching showed the natural subsoil and archaeological horizon to be well-preserved at depth below colluvial silt/sands. A small assemblage of prehistoric material, together with two undated ditches and three possible pits indicates a possible phase of prehistoric occupation in the vicinity. A medieval or post-medieval ditch and isolated post-medieval small finds indicates that the site has probably been open or arable land since the medieval period.
